Convert the Dumpster's Casters to Rail Wheels

The biggest part of your dumpster-to-mining cart conversion is the wheels. Small dumpsters work best, and they already have heavy-duty casters. These casters need to be removed and replaced with rail wheels, which you can purchase from a mining supply company. You may have to enlist the help of a professional welder to complete the job, since the dumpster casters may have to be cut off and the added central pin support for the rail wheels will need to be welded on to the ends of the rods. Once you have this conversion step complete, the next step is the brakes.

Add Brakes

Most mining carts have a brake. This could be a manual hand brake (which is very unusual and somewhat outdated) or just a wheel brake that is activated automatically via some wiring and a switch on the cart. The old, individual caster brakes on the dumpster wheels will not be sufficient because of the speed of the mining cart, the weight of rock and the differences between dumpster casters and rail wheels. Consult with an engineer and your welder how to best approach the brake issue, since most mining operations will require the carts to have a braking system.

Make the Dumpster Lids Optional

Most mining operations need the carts to be fully open and ready to receive mined rock. On occasion, extra carts may remain in a side tunnel, holding precious minerals or stones until enough can be mined to move these carts out of the mine shaft. That said, your dumpster-to-mining cart conversion should include optional lids so that the miners can choose to close and cover the carts or pop the covers off to keep them open. If you do not rent dumpsters that already have optional lids, consider making alterations to the lid hinges or invest in some dumpsters that have pop-off lids prior to making the necessary conversions to create your mining carts-for-rent.
